VA RFI: Connected Care Platform

Notice ID: 36C10B22Q0149

“BACKGROUND: Building upon the success of the Mobile Application Cloud Migration (MACM) platform, VA’s Office of Information and Technology (OIT) seeks to continue operating the platform (hereafter known as the Connected Care Platform) within the VA Enterprise Cloud as well as to continue performing adaptive, perfective, corrective, and preventive maintenance.  This platform provides compute spaces for: responsive websites, middleware (services supporting websites and mobile applications), commercial off-the-shelf products, and databases.”

“SCOPE OF WORK: Using Site Reliability Engineering (SRE) practices, techniques, and concepts, the Contractor shall continuously operate, and provide Adaptive, Perfective, Preventive, and Corrective Maintenance for, the “Connected Care PLATFORM” (CCP), formerly known as MACM, within the VA Enterprise Cloud (VAEC).”

“Operating and performing Adaptive, Perfective, and Preventive Maintenance shall include:

  • Modernization necessary to meet service level objectives (SLO).
  • Software license management.
  • Site Reliability Engineering services that deliver maintenance and operations shared services to Product Teams that use industry standard DevSecOps and Scaled Agile Framework practices and techniques.
  • Providing associated infrastructure architectural services needed to adapt and perfect the CCP.
  • Implementing and provisioning – as part of adapting to an expanding tenant count – additional virtual private clouds / virtual networks
  • Adding VAEC commercial cloud instantiations to the CCP”

“The Contractor shall not be responsible for providing or acquiring cloud capacity or server hosting infrastructure for this contract. VA will furnish VAEC capacity as GFE.”
